Zepbound (tirzepatide) weekly injection dosing schedule The weekly dosing schedule of Zepboud is as follows: Weeks 1-4 (starting dose): 2.5 mg once weekly for the first 4 weeks Weeks 5-8: 5 mg once weekly Weeks 9-12: 7.5 mg once weekly Weeks 13-16 : If tolerated, increase to 10 mg once weekly Weeks 17-20: If the dosage needs to be escalated further, increase to 12.5 mg once weekly for 4 weeks Weeks 21 and onward : If the previous dose is ineffective, the next dose will be 15 mg once weekly
